Why Yuba City home owners require a cautious screening process
Solar in Yuba City makes good sense for numerous houses. The location gets strong sun, cooling loads can be significant in the warmer months, and electrical power expenses are high sufficient that a properly designed system can supply purposeful savings with time. But those exact same benefits draw in a crowded sales environment, and that is where property owners can enter into trouble.
A solar setup is not just a purchase of panels. It is a roof covering decision, an electric decision, a funding choice, and in some cases a resale decision. A firm can provide excellent equipment and still do poor installment job. An additional can set up neatly however oversize or undersize the system. I have seen proposals where the production price quote looked generous on paper, yet the roof had apparent afternoon color that would certainly minimize performance. I have likewise seen property owners indicator long funding arrangements without fully understanding just how dealership fees changed the actual price of the system.
The finest installers put in the time to explain the whole photo. They do not hurry previous roofing system age, main panel ability, attic room heat, vent positioning, or whether your future power usage is likely to enhance as a result of an electrical vehicle, swimming pool pump, or heatpump conversion. Those details matter greater than shiny brochures.
Start with your house, not the sales pitch
Before you compare firms, take stock of your very own property. That offers you a much stronger placement when you begin assessing solar installment firms near me or asking for proposals from solar installers near me.
Your roof covering is the very first filter. If it is nearing the end of its life, solar must typically wait up until reroofing is managed, or both tasks need to be coordinated. Getting rid of and re-installing panels later includes expense and inconvenience. In practice, a roof with ten or more excellent years left is usually convenient, yet materials, slope, and present problem issue. Tile roofs can be superb for long life, yet they call for even more care and experience during installation. Compound roof shingles roofing systems are common and usually uncomplicated, provided the outdoor decking and underlayment remain in excellent shape.
Next, consider your electrical use. Draw a complete year of utility costs when possible. A single summer season tells only part of the story. Some Yuba City families run heavy a/c in July and August, while others have extra balanced use year-round. Annual kilowatt-hour intake aids determine system dimension more properly than thinking based on square video or panel count.
Then think ahead. A household that prepares to acquire an EV following year need to not size the system only around today's expenses. The same goes for property owners who anticipate to include a workshop, switch from gas to electrical appliances, or set up a hot tub. A wise installer will certainly ask about future load modifications without pressing you into a puffed up system.
What divides a strong solar installer from a weak one
A reputable installer generally stands out much less by what they guarantee and more by just how they run. Their proposition is meaningful. Their website go to is specific. Their solutions are direct. They can clarify style options . They are not threatened by mindful questions.
A weak service provider typically depends on necessity. They lean hard on "sign today" price cuts, slightly worded cost savings cases, or filled with air energy price presumptions. They may skip vital information throughout the first consultation since they are a lot more focused on closing than on style quality.
One of the clearest indicators of expertise is whether the firm deals with the project as a personalized build rather than a canned bundle. 2 bordering homes in Yuba City can require different system designs due to roof orientation, vent locations, shielding, or main panel constraints. Excellent installers make up those restrictions up front.
Experience likewise matters, however it needs to be interpreted very carefully. A firm that has actually been around for fifteen years might still send out unskilled staffs if it has expanded also rapidly or counts greatly on subcontractors. On the other hand, a newer local firm might have a very capable lead electrical expert and solid project administration. Period helps, yet you want evidence of experienced execution, not just a long organization history.
Questions worth asking prior to you authorize anything
When property owners look for solar setup Yuba City solutions, they frequently contrast price initially. Price issues, yet it ought to follow you establish who is really qualified to do the job. A sharp collection of inquiries will tell you even more than the marketing packet.
Ask who designs the system and whether the style modifications after the website examination. It is not unusual for a very early price quote to evolve once a person measures the roofing system, checks the electrical panel, and takes a look at shade conditions. What you intend to hear is that the installer invites those refinements rather than pretending every home fits a typical template.
Ask who does the setup. Some firms use in-house staffs. Others farm out all labor. Subcontracting is not instantly negative, but it produces another layer of accountability. If there is a roofing leakage, channel problem, or service delay, you need to understand that possesses the problem.
Ask exactly how they estimate manufacturing. A great response referrals roofing system azimuth, tilt, color, local irradiance assumptions, and system losses. A weak response is obscure and sleek, with no explanation of the math.
Ask about service after commissioning. Solar is reduced upkeep, however not maintenance-free. Inverters can fall short. Surveillance can go offline. A pest guard might be needed later on if birds become a trouble. The installer should inform you just how service telephone calls are handled and what reaction time is realistic.
Ask just how the warranty works in method. There are normally numerous warranties included: panel product service warranty, inverter service warranty, handiwork service warranty, and in some cases roofing infiltration insurance coverage. The home owner requires to recognize which company guarantees which problem. A 25-year devices warranty appears reassuring until you learn that labor is minimal or that the original installer is tough to reach.
The proposition ought to make good sense without a sales representative in the room
A solid proposal can stand on its very own. If you have to keep calling the salesperson to decode standard information, that is a bad indicator. At minimum, you ought to have the ability to determine the system size in kilowatts, approximated annual manufacturing in kilowatt-hours, panel and inverter brands, funding terms if relevant, and the total expense before and after any kind of appropriate incentives.
The production quote is entitled to special scrutiny. Installers can make numbers look much better by utilizing hopeful utility rising cost of living presumptions or by underplaying system deterioration. The estimate must not be dealt with as a guarantee, but it needs to feel probable based on your roofing and usage. If one business anticipates drastically much more manufacturing than the others utilizing similar equipment on the same roofing system, ask why. Often there is a genuine layout advantage. Frequently there is not.
I have actually seen property owners pick the greatest approximated manufacturing because it made the payback duration look much shorter, just to find out later on that the design consisted of panel positionings near obstructions or on roofing system planes with substandard exposure. A practical quote is far better than an amazing one.
Pricing, financing, and the trap of concentrating just on regular monthly payment
One of the greatest blunders in domestic solar buying is contrasting month-to-month settlements as opposed to complete task business economics. This is especially common when sales representatives pitch funding before they have actually even wrapped up system design.
A lower regular monthly payment may come from a much longer finance term, a larger dealership fee, an intro structure, or assumptions about applying a tax obligation credit report in a particular means. It can still be the right choice in many cases, however you need to see the actual numbers clearly.
Here are the prices information worth comparing throughout propositions:
- Total cash money rate of the system
- Loan term, rates of interest, and any type of dealer fees
- Estimated yearly production, not just panel count
- Equipment brand names and service warranty coverage
- Cost per watt, utilized meticulously together with quality and scope
Cost per watt is a valuable comparison device, yet not a full one. A a little higher price may be warranted if the installer is using far better inverters, more powerful workmanship insurance coverage, or a format that stays clear of future headaches. On the other hand, a proposal that is drastically above market ought to feature an excellent explanation.
When reviewing funding, read the arrangement gradually. Some house owners are amazed to learn that "same as cash money" language does not always suggest what they believe it indicates, or that forecasted cost savings rely on making a large lump-sum repayment after obtaining a tax obligation credit rating. That is not always an offer breaker, yet it should never come as a surprise after signing.
Local understanding matters more than many purchasers realize
There is genuine value in working with a firm accustomed to Yuba City and the surrounding region. Climate, utility billing patterns, allowing assumptions, and typical roof kinds all shape just how efficiently a task goes. An installer who consistently operates in the location is more likely to recognize the normal sticking points prior to they become delays.
This does not imply you should pick the tiniest neighborhood company. Some larger local business do superb job and preserve strong regional teams. The trick is whether the people managing your job recognize the neighborhood problems and have a useful procedure for navigating them.
For example, summer season warm in the Sacramento Valley affects working problems, attic temperatures, and organizing facts. Experienced crews plan around that. They likewise know that property owners in this area commonly have strong cooling lots, which can make exact countered computations specifically essential. A cookie-cutter layout from an out-of-area sales workplace may miss those nuances.

Roof job, electric work, and why the most inexpensive installment can obtain expensive later
Solar sits at the crossway of 2 professions that leave little area for sloppiness. Roofing system penetrations need to be effectively flashed and sealed. Electric job needs to satisfy code and be easily implemented. If either side is weak, you can wind up with leakages, nuisance shutdowns, stopped working examinations, or hideous avenue runs that pain curb appeal.
Homeowners often focus on the visible devices, panels and inverters, but workmanship lives in the details. Are attachments flashed properly? Is conduit directed neatly? Is the variety set out symmetrically where feasible? Does the crew safeguard roofing system materials while functioning? Is the electric labeling specialist and code-compliant instead of added as an afterthought?
A couple of years down the line, these details different systems that just date systems that proceed executing with very little difficulty. Excellent installers understand that a tidy mount is not cosmetic vanity. If your roofing has special conditions, such as weak floor tile, multiple dormers, limited attic room access, or an older major panel, bring those problems up early. The most effective companies will not wave them away. They will certainly clarify the compromises, feasible included costs, and style restrictions in a manner that allows you decide with eyes open.
Reviews assist, yet only if you read them carefully
Online testimonials can be valuable, however celebrity ratings alone are blunt tools. Check out for patterns. Do property owners discuss clear interaction, exact timelines, clean craftsmanship, and responsive service after setup? Or do you see repeated grievances concerning adjustment orders, going away sales reps, or long waits to deal with surveillance issues?
Pay attention to how companies react to criticism. A thoughtful action that attends to the issue without obtaining defensive is frequently an excellent sign. So is a mix of comprehensive reviews over time instead of an unexpected burst of obscure first-class praise.
It likewise aids to ask for current regional recommendations. A trusted installer ought to fit attaching you with clients in or near Yuba City who had similar jobs. Speaking with 1 or 2 house owners can disclose things a proposition never ever will, such as whether the crew appeared in a timely manner, whether the final system matched the initial pledge, and how the firm handled the unavoidable hiccups.
When batteries make good sense, and when they do not
Battery storage is just one of one of the most talked about topics in home solar now, and it is likewise among the easiest locations for overselling. A battery can be a solid enhancement if your objectives include backup power throughout interruptions, moving power use, or minimizing reliance on the grid during costly amount of time. Yet not every Yuba City household needs one immediately.
If your primary goal is reducing energy bills and your grid service is typically reputable, a solar-only system may still be the much more practical initial step. If your home experiences outages or you have clinical devices, refrigeration requirements, or a work-from-home setup that can not endure disturbances, a battery is worthy of major consideration.
The vital point is that the installer discusses what the battery will certainly and will certainly not power. Some home owners think one battery backs up the entire residence forever. In truth, backup duration depends on battery capacity, vital lots, solar production, weather condition, and usage practices. An excellent specialist will certainly go through those restrictions in simple terms.
Signs you ought to keep shopping
Even if a firm looks polished, there are moments when it makes good sense to walk away. Depend on your reactions if the procedure feels unsafe. The best installers recognize that an educated buyer is normally a much better long-lasting customer.
Watch for these red flags:
- Pressure to sign promptly to "secure" a discount
- Vague responses regarding subcontractors or who manages service
- Production estimates that seem a lot more than completing proposals without a clear reason
- Financing discussions that prevent the overall price of the system
- Little interest in roof condition, electrical panel condition, or your real use history
A qualified solar firm is selling a twenty-plus-year asset. They should not need tricks to get your signature.
Comparing propositions without obtaining overwhelmed
Once you have actually tightened your search to two or three significant prospects, compare them line by line. This is where many homeowners make the final blunder of returning to suspicion or straightforward cost contrast. A better technique is to deal with the proposals like building and construction files and cost savings prepares combined.
First, look at system size versus anticipated production. These are not interchangeable. A somewhat smaller system can in some cases generate nearly as much as a bigger one if the design is extra reliable or panels are placed on far better roof planes.
Second, compare devices selections in context. Costs panels can be beneficial, yet just if they solve a real design restraint or provide worth you care about, such as better guarantee terms, enhanced performance on limited roof area, or more powerful warmth efficiency. The best option is not constantly the most expensive hardware.
Third, contrast workmanship and solution dedications. If one business has a recognized local solution group and a documented procedure for warranty insurance claims, that might outweigh a modest cost difference.
Fourth, take a look at the timeline realistically. Some home owners need installation prior to optimal summer season usage. Others care extra about obtaining reroofing collaborated initially. The appropriate installer assists series the task in a way that avoids future rework.
Finally, take into consideration communication high quality. This seems subjective, yet it matters. Projects go extra efficiently when the business addresses concerns plainly, papers adjustments, and follows through on what it says.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Yuba City?
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years. While power output gradually declines over time, panels often continue producing electricity beyond their warranty period. Routine maintenance helps maintain performance throughout their lifespan. Inverters typically require replacement sooner, often after 10 to 15 years.
